# Daybreak service environments

Daybreak handles date-format localization for all Lumenmark products. Staging mirrors production locale bundles but refreshes nightly, so a reviewed change may take a day to show up there. When reviewing, check that new format patterns exist in every supported locale bundle, not just the default one — missing entries fall back silently and are easy to miss. Each environment loads its own locale and formatting settings, which currently look like this:

deployment values, taweg-bajop:
[fenvan]
port = 5672
team = holmir
host = fenvan.orvexio.example
region = lower-1
access_code = ac_b98bc6
timeout_ms = 1500

## Formula sandbox tuning

User-supplied formulas in Gridmoor execute inside a restricted interpreter with hard ceilings on time, memory, and call depth. Reviewers should confirm any change to these ceilings is justified in the PR description, since raising them widens the abuse surface. Defaults were chosen from production traces. The current limits are as follows.

limits module of tafog-fawip:
WEIGHTS = {
    "julix": 57,
    "lamys": 992,
    "kasvan": 209,
    "quenok": 750,
    "alddor": 259,
    "oliath": 1009,
    "wenix": 815,
}

Finance Review Summary — Lease Renegotiation

Quick update on the Bramwell Yard lease. Landlord (Torvik Holdings) opened at a 12% uplift; we countered flat with a two-year extension and got them to 4% plus a tenant improvement credit. Honestly a decent outcome given the local market. Cash impact is roughly 60k annually versus their opening ask. Signing targeted for the 20th. Context on where this fits strategically follows below.

internal memo for tawip-hahaf: The eastern region missed its Kasok quota by 35.3 percent last quarter. Zorixox Holdings plans to lower the Eliael list price by 36.6 percent in May. The steering committee signed off on a budget of $98.5 million for Project Rusvan. The renewal with Soraxix Logistics closes at $424.5 million a year, 62.9 percent above the last contract.